在当今这个快速发展的商业时代,供应链管理已经成为企业竞争的核心要素之一。而供应链系统的源码,作为企业高效运转的秘密武器,其重要性不言而喻。接下来,我们就来揭秘供应链系统源码,看看它是如何助力企业实现高效运转的。
供应链系统概述
首先,让我们来了解一下什么是供应链系统。供应链系统是指从原材料采购、生产、加工、仓储、运输到最终销售整个过程的信息管理系统。它通过优化各个环节,降低成本,提高效率,从而实现企业整体运营的优化。
供应链系统源码的重要性
- 提高企业竞争力:拥有先进的供应链系统源码,可以帮助企业快速响应市场变化,提高客户满意度,从而在激烈的市场竞争中脱颖而出。
- 降低运营成本:通过优化供应链各个环节,降低库存成本、运输成本等,实现企业整体成本控制。
- 提高生产效率:供应链系统源码可以帮助企业实现生产计划的自动化、智能化,提高生产效率。
- 提升客户满意度:通过优化供应链管理,缩短交货周期,提高客户满意度。
供应链系统源码揭秘
1. 数据库设计
数据库是供应链系统的核心,其设计的好坏直接影响系统的性能。以下是一个简单的数据库设计示例:
-- 供应商表
CREATE TABLE suppliers (
supplier_id INT PRIMARY KEY,
supplier_name VARCHAR(100),
contact_person VARCHAR(100),
phone_number VARCHAR(20)
);
-- 产品表
CREATE TABLE products (
product_id INT PRIMARY KEY,
product_name VARCHAR(100),
category_id INT,
price DECIMAL(10, 2),
stock INT
);
-- 订单表
CREATE TABLE orders (
order_id INT PRIMARY KEY,
customer_id INT,
order_date DATE,
status VARCHAR(20)
);
2. 业务逻辑
业务逻辑是供应链系统的灵魂,以下是一个简单的业务逻辑示例:
def create_order(customer_id, product_id, quantity):
# 检查库存
if check_stock(product_id, quantity):
# 创建订单
order = Order(order_id, customer_id, product_id, quantity)
# 减少库存
decrease_stock(product_id, quantity)
return order
else:
return None
3. 用户界面
用户界面是供应链系统与用户交互的桥梁,以下是一个简单的用户界面示例:
<!DOCTYPE html>
<html>
<head>
<title>供应链系统</title>
</head>
<body>
<h1>创建订单</h1>
<form action="/create_order" method="post">
客户ID:<input type="text" name="customer_id" required><br>
产品ID:<input type="text" name="product_id" required><br>
数量:<input type="number" name="quantity" required><br>
<input type="submit" value="创建订单">
</form>
</body>
</html>
总结
供应链系统源码是企业高效运转的秘密武器。通过深入了解供应链系统源码,我们可以更好地优化企业运营,提高竞争力。当然,这只是一个简单的示例,实际应用中还需要根据企业需求进行定制化开发。希望本文能帮助你更好地了解供应链系统源码,为你的企业带来更多价值。
